There are several reasons why some casino can bee blacklisted and this are some main of them.

If a site fails to use a proper Random Number Generator to ensure that all deals, spins, and rolls of the dice are random, or if that RNG is found to be flawed or “fixed”, the online casino is come to our blacklist.

All games should be random for them to be fair. A scam casino will rip off their games and/or alter them in such a way that they’re given the advantage (on top of the advantage these games already give casinos).

A scam casino may also tweak their free practice games to favorit players to encourage them to play the lesser “fair” paid games.

We all play to have fun, but we also play to win money. A shady casino will take weeks, months or even years to pay players back, either because they don’t have the cash flow -which is scary- or because they want to encourage the player to continue playing or to take a bonus so that they won’t cash out. Both are rogue behavior. But when a casino leaves you hanging and the check never shows up in the mail? That’s not cool. Not all bad online casinos that are blacklisted lie about sending you money. In fact, most don’t. Instead, they’ll tell you straight up that you don’t qualify for a withdrawal because you violated certain bonus conditions or didn’t meet the deposit requirements.

Casinos that advertise free money and then make you jump over the hoops to claim a bonus, and they do not put it anywhere in their terms are find place on our blacklist. We do take fraudents seriously.

We believe in fair marketing practices. That’s why the worst casinos that engage in spamming players and not adhering to marketing best practices are easily cross from our recommended list to our blacklist.

Every online casino requires that you provide your email address during the registration process. This is a perfectly standard practice that allows sites to send you offers and promotional information.

But no internet casino should use your email address to spam you with countless and possibly unwanted offers. Unfortunately, I’ve signed up at a few sites that began sending me offers on a daily basis. It’s great to be kept in the loop about promotions, but not when it’s cluttering up my email inbox. You can easily opt out of most casino newsletters. But some sites make it difficult to do so in hopes that you’ll give up.

One of the sneakiest things rogue casinos do is change their terms on the fly, on an as-needed basis. They’ll do this when they’re in dispute with a player over something they say the player’s done wrong, but hasn’t really. They’ll change the terms to support their argument. Yet, when you look at the archives you can see the terms were recently changed from siding with the player …to siding with the casino.

Casinos that have poor customer service, lack of responsiveness, unstable software or provide genuinely unethical player experiences get added to our blacklist. We also blacklist casinos that fail to include the proper encryption technology that’s needed to keep your information and financial details safe.
